Isaías 11
Nueva Biblia de las Américas
Reinado justo del Mesías
11 Entonces un retoño(A) brotará del tronco de Isaí(B),
Y un vástago(C) dará fruto de sus raíces(D).
2 Y reposará sobre Él el Espíritu del Señor(E),
Espíritu de sabiduría y de inteligencia(F),
Espíritu de consejo y de poder(G),
Espíritu de conocimiento y de temor del Señor.
3 Él se deleitará en el temor del Señor,
Y no juzgará por lo que vean Sus ojos,
Ni sentenciará por lo que oigan Sus oídos(H);
4 Sino que juzgará al pobre(I) con justicia(J),
Y fallará con equidad por los afligidos de la tierra(K).
Herirá la tierra con la vara de Su boca(L),
Y con el soplo de Sus labios matará al impío(M).
5 La justicia será ceñidor de Sus lomos(N),
Y la fidelidad ceñidor de Su cintura(O).
6 ¶El lobo morará con el cordero,
Y el leopardo se echará con el cabrito.
El becerro, el leoncillo y el animal doméstico[a] andarán juntos[b](P),
Y un niño los conducirá.
7 La vaca con la osa pastará,
Sus crías se echarán juntas,
Y el león, como el buey, comerá paja(Q).
8 El niño de pecho jugará junto a la cueva de la cobra,
Y el niño destetado extenderá su mano sobre la guarida de la víbora.
9 No dañarán ni destruirán en todo Mi santo monte(R),
Porque la tierra estará llena del conocimiento del Señor
Como las aguas cubren el mar(S).
10 ¶Acontecerá en aquel día
Que las naciones(T) acudirán a la raíz de Isaí(U),
Que estará puesta como señal[c] para los pueblos(V),
Y será gloriosa[d] Su morada[e](W).
11 ¶Entonces acontecerá en aquel día que el Señor
Ha de recobrar de nuevo con Su mano, por segunda vez,
Al remanente de Su pueblo(X) que haya quedado
De Asiria(Y), de Egipto(Z), de Patros, de Cus[f], de Elam(AA), de Sinar, de Hamat
Y de las islas[g] del mar(AB).
12 Alzará un estandarte ante las naciones(AC),
Reunirá a los desterrados de Israel,
Y juntará a los dispersos de Judá(AD)
De los cuatro confines de la tierra.
13 Entonces se disipará la envidia de Efraín,
Y los que hostigan a Judá serán exterminados.
Efraín no envidiará a Judá,
Ni Judá hostigará a Efraín(AE).
14 Ellos se lanzarán[h](AF) sobre el costado de los filisteos al occidente(AG),
Juntos despojarán a los hijos del oriente(AH).
Edom(AI) y Moab(AJ) estarán bajo su dominio[i],
Y los amonitas les estarán sujetos[j].
15 Y el Señor destruirá[k](AK)
La lengua del mar de Egipto[l].
Agitará Su mano sobre el Río[m](AL)
Con Su viento abrasador;
Lo partirá en siete arroyos
Y hará que se pueda pasar en sandalias.
16 Y habrá una calzada desde Asiria(AM)
Para el remanente que quede de Su pueblo(AN),
Así como la hubo para Israel
El día que subieron de la tierra de Egipto(AO).

Isaiah 11
English Standard Version
The Righteous Reign of the Branch
11 There shall come forth a shoot from the stump of (A)Jesse,
and a branch from his roots shall bear fruit.
2 And (B)the Spirit of the Lord shall rest upon him,
the Spirit of wisdom and understanding,
the Spirit of counsel and might,
the Spirit of knowledge and the fear of the Lord.
3 And his delight shall be in the fear of the Lord.
(C)He shall not judge by (D)what his eyes see,
or decide disputes by (E)what his ears hear,
4 but (F)with righteousness he shall judge the poor,
and decide with equity for the meek of the earth;
and he shall (G)strike the earth with the rod of his mouth,
and (H)with the breath of his lips (I)he shall kill the wicked.
5 Righteousness shall be the belt of his waist,
and (J)faithfulness the belt of his loins.
6 (K)The wolf shall dwell with the lamb,
and the leopard shall lie down with the young goat,
and the calf and the lion and the fattened calf together;
and a little child shall lead them.
7 The cow and the bear shall graze;
their young shall lie down together;
and the lion shall eat straw like the ox.
8 The nursing child shall play over the hole of the cobra,
and the weaned child shall put his hand on the adder's den.
9 (L)They shall not hurt or destroy
in all (M)my holy mountain;
(N)for the earth shall be full of the knowledge of the Lord
as the waters cover the sea.
10 In that day (O)the root of (P)Jesse, who shall stand as (Q)a signal for the peoples—of him shall the nations inquire, and his resting place shall be glorious.
11 (R)In that day the Lord will extend his hand yet a second time to recover the remnant that remains of his people, (S)from Assyria, (T)from Egypt, from (U)Pathros, from (V)Cush,[a] from (W)Elam, from (X)Shinar, from (Y)Hamath, and from (Z)the coastlands of the sea.
12 He will raise (AA)a signal for the nations
and will assemble (AB)the banished of Israel,
and gather the dispersed of Judah
from the four corners of the earth.
13 (AC)The jealousy of Ephraim shall depart,
and those who harass Judah shall be cut off;
Ephraim shall not be jealous of Judah,
and Judah shall not harass Ephraim.
14 (AD)But they shall swoop down on the shoulder of the Philistines in the west,
and together they shall plunder (AE)the people of the east.
They shall put out their hand (AF)against (AG)Edom and (AH)Moab,
and (AI)the Ammonites shall obey them.
15 And the Lord will utterly destroy[b]
(AJ)the tongue of the Sea of Egypt,
and will wave his hand over (AK)the River[c]
with his scorching breath,[d]
and strike it into seven channels,
and he will lead people across in sandals.
16 And there will be (AL)a highway from Assyria
for the remnant that remains of his people,
(AM)as there was for Israel
when they came up from the land of Egypt.

Isaiah 11
King James Version
11 And there shall come forth a rod out of the stem of Jesse, and a Branch shall grow out of his roots:
2 And the spirit of the Lord shall rest upon him, the spirit of wisdom and understanding, the spirit of counsel and might, the spirit of knowledge and of the fear of the Lord;
3 And shall make him of quick understanding in the fear of the Lord: and he shall not judge after the sight of his eyes, neither reprove after the hearing of his ears:
4 But with righteousness shall he judge the poor, and reprove with equity for the meek of the earth: and he shall smite the earth: with the rod of his mouth, and with the breath of his lips shall he slay the wicked.
5 And righteousness shall be the girdle of his loins, and faithfulness the girdle of his reins.
6 The wolf also shall dwell with the lamb, and the leopard shall lie down with the kid; and the calf and the young lion and the fatling together; and a little child shall lead them.
7 And the cow and the bear shall feed; their young ones shall lie down together: and the lion shall eat straw like the ox.
8 And the sucking child shall play on the hole of the asp, and the weaned child shall put his hand on the cockatrice' den.
9 They shall not hurt nor destroy in all my holy mountain: for the earth shall be full of the knowledge of the Lord, as the waters cover the sea.
10 And in that day there shall be a root of Jesse, which shall stand for an ensign of the people; to it shall the Gentiles seek: and his rest shall be glorious.
11 And it shall come to pass in that day, that the Lord shall set his hand again the second time to recover the remnant of his people, which shall be left, from Assyria, and from Egypt, and from Pathros, and from Cush, and from Elam, and from Shinar, and from Hamath, and from the islands of the sea.
12 And he shall set up an ensign for the nations, and shall assemble the outcasts of Israel, and gather together the dispersed of Judah from the four corners of the earth.
13 The envy also of Ephraim shall depart, and the adversaries of Judah shall be cut off: Ephraim shall not envy Judah, and Judah shall not vex Ephraim.
14 But they shall fly upon the shoulders of the Philistines toward the west; they shall spoil them of the east together: they shall lay their hand upon Edom and Moab; and the children of Ammon shall obey them.
15 And the Lord shall utterly destroy the tongue of the Egyptian sea; and with his mighty wind shall he shake his hand over the river, and shall smite it in the seven streams, and make men go over dryshod.
16 And there shall be an highway for the remnant of his people, which shall be left, from Assyria; like as it was to Israel in the day that he came up out of the land of Egypt.
